Electric Panel Replacement in Prescott Valley, AZ
Electric panel replacement services involve removing an outdated or damaged electrical panel and installing a new, more efficient one. This process typically covers upgrading panels to meet increased power demands, replacing units that are malfunctioning or unsafe, and ensuring the electrical system complies with current standards. Homeowners often request this service when experiencing frequent breaker trips, flickering lights, or signs of electrical deterioration, and they want to understand the scope of work involved, the compatibility of new panels with existing wiring, and any necessary upgrades to accommodate modern appliances and electronics.
Before requesting an electric panel replacement, property owners should consider the age and condition of their current panel, as well as any future electrical needs. It’s important to assess whether the existing system can support additional circuits or higher power loads. Understanding the potential benefits of upgrading, such as improved safety, increased capacity, and enhanced energy efficiency, can help homeowners make informed decisions. Consulting with a professional can clarify the process, costs involved, and any permits or inspections that might be required.

Electric Panel Replacement Questions
What are signs that an electric panel needs replacement? Signs include frequent breaker trips, burning smells, or visible damage to the panel or wiring.
Why should a homeowner consider replacing an electric panel? Upgrading enhances safety, supports increased electrical demand, and ensures code compliance.
What types of projects typically require electric panel replacement? Projects include home renovations, adding new appliances, or updating outdated electrical systems.
How can property owners determine if their electric panel is outdated? An inspection can reveal if the panel is too old, lacks capacity, or shows signs of wear and tear.
